Florida condo statute resources
Plain-language guides to the Florida condominium statutes that boards and unit owners ask about most. Each page cites the statute text and links to the official source at leg.state.fl.us.
- Records requestss. 718.111(12)
The 10-business-day clock, what records the association must produce, and the $50/day penalty for late responses.
- Fines and hearingss. 718.303
The due-process chain: 14-day notice, independent committee hearing, $100 per violation cap, and why condo fines cannot become a lien.
- Reserves and SIRSs. 718.112(2)(f)+(g)
Post-Surfside reserve funding requirements, the 8 structural components, and why boards can no longer waive structural reserves.
- Assessment collections. 718.116
The automatic lien, 45-day pre-lien notice, lien priority over first mortgages, and the foreclosure process.
- Website requirements (HB 913)s. 718.111(12)(g)
Effective January 1, 2026: associations with 25+ units must maintain a website with specific documents posted.
